mirror horizontal

The attached documents contain macros. To examine the problem, you need to
enable macro execution.

Open the document and allow macros.
Select the shape.
Press Alt+F11.
>From the library of the document select makro "mail" and run it.

You will notice, that rotation works, but not vertical or horizontal flip.

To verify, that it is a problem for custom shapes, you can draw a Bézier-curve
for example and apply the macro to the curve.
